Message type: E = Error
Message class: CRM_BSP_GEN_UI_BI -
Message number: 003
Message text: JavaScript error while calling BI report type '&1'
A JavaScript Error occured during communication between WebClient and
BI while accessing a report of type '&V1&'. The error message starts
with:
&V2&
The URL to call BI starts with:
&V3&
The BI report might not offer to full functionality or sessions will not
end properly
Contact your system admininstrator
In most cases the system configuration is not matching or browser
settings are not matching. Here the most important requirements:
The calling system and the BI system must use the same protocol. Either
both use http or both use https.
The calling system and the BI system must have the same security zone in
the browser (e.g. Intranet Zone)
The calling system and the BI system must have the same domain, e.g.
crm.domain.net and bi.domain.net
For more information on that issue see notes 1138613, 1283396, 1242033,
1268401

- JavaScript error while calling BI report type '&1' ?The SAP error message
CRM_BSP_GEN_UI_BI003
typically indicates a JavaScript error that occurs when trying to call a Business Intelligence (BI) report in the SAP CRM (Customer Relationship Management) system. This error can arise due to various reasons, including configuration issues, data inconsistencies, or problems with the BI report itself.Causes:
- JavaScript Errors: There may be issues in the JavaScript code that is executed when the BI report is called.
- Missing or Incorrect Configuration: The BI report may not be properly configured in the SAP system, leading to errors when it is invoked.
- Data Issues: The data being processed by the BI report may be inconsistent or corrupted, causing the report to fail.
- Browser Compatibility: Sometimes, the browser being used may not be compatible with the SAP UI, leading to JavaScript errors.
-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to access the BI report, which can lead to errors.
Solutions:
- Check JavaScript Console: Open the browser's developer tools (usually F12) and check the JavaScript console for any specific error messages that can provide more context.
- Review Configuration: Ensure that the BI report is correctly configured in the SAP system. Check the settings in the SAP GUI and ensure that all required parameters are set correctly.
- Data Validation: Validate the data being used in the BI report. Ensure that there are no inconsistencies or missing data that could cause the report to fail.
- Browser Compatibility: Try accessing the report using a different browser or updating the current browser to the latest version. Ensure that the browser settings allow for JavaScript execution.
- Check Authorizations: Verify that the user has the necessary authorizations to access the BI report. This can be done by checking the user roles and permissions in the SAP system.
- SAP Notes: Check for any relevant SAP Notes or patches that may address this specific error. SAP frequently releases updates that fix known issues.
- Contact Support: If the issue persists, consider reaching out to SAP support for further assistance. Provide them with detailed information about the error, including any error codes and the context in which it occurs.
